How to Reduce Your Environmental Footprint?
The 3R rule (reduce, reuse, recycle) was presented at the G8 Summit in June 2004 with the aim of building a recycling-oriented society and encouraging habits such as responsible consumption. Life on planet Earth depends on the Sun. Energy from the Sun in the form of light is captured by plants, some bacteria and protists, through the wonderful phenomenon of photosynthesis. The captured energy transforms carbon dioxide into organic compounds, such as sugars, and oxygen is produced. When sunlight reaches the Earth's surface, it is partially absorbed and then re-radiated as infrared heat. Most of this heat is absorbed by greenhouse gases that warm the Earth, resulting in a generally warmer climate and higher levels of carbon dioxide, which can threaten our lives and our planet for generations to come. This is why today it is extremely important that we pay attention to the environmental impact generated by our actions. So, how do we do it exactly? Here are some simple ways to live a healthier and more sustainable lifestyle to protect the environment. Among them: reduce, reuse and recycle.

Reduce, reuse and recycle responsibly

  • Reduce: This mainly refers to consuming less (preferring products with less packaging; refilling a water bottle each time instead of buying a new one; choosing family-size containers, etc.) in a more responsible way, but also to reducing our water and energy consumption, since current sources are highly polluting.
  • Reuse: Seeks to extend the life of each product. Most goods can have more than one useful life, either by repairing them or using imagination to give them another use.

  • Recycle: Rescuing a material that is no longer useful and turning it into a new product. The raw material is reincorporated into the cycle to manufacture new products without the need to increase energy expenditure or waste volume.

Household separation is complemented, therefore, by the recycling and reuse of products, responsible consumption, and composting of organic waste. These practices lead to numerous benefits:

Environmental benefits:

  • Healthier cities are achieved.
  • Reduction in the consumption of renewable and non-renewable natural resources destined for industrial production, such as forests, minerals, water, oil and energy.
  • Greenhouse gas emissions that contribute to global warming are reduced.
  • It allows many producing companies to purchase raw materials from the recycling cycle to manufacture new products.

Lithium-ion batteries for forklifts provide a variety of efficiency advantages that can offer an excellent return on investment for those in the warehouse and material handling space when properly managed. By not containing highly polluting metals such as cadmium, they are much less aggressive to the environment. In machines such as forklifts, lithium batteries avoid noise pollution, have no acid corrosion and do not emit harmful vapors during the charging process. In addition, lithium batteries maintain their charge for extended periods of time. They only lose around 5% of their charge per month, further reducing environmental impact.
